How personal loans work in Middlesborough
A Middlesborough personal loan is an installment loan: a lump sum, then fixed monthly payments over a set term, priced off your credit rather than its 9,012 residents. The rate you see advertised is a range, not a promise, until a lender reviews your file in Middlesborough. A longer term lowers the monthly payment on a Middlesborough loan but raises total interest, so the smallest payment is not the cheapest loan.

Kentucky rules behind a Middlesborough personal loan
Every row below records a Kentucky rule, its publisher and its retrieval date — the same rules a Middlesborough lender must follow.
| Rule | Detail | Source |
|---|---|---|
| State lending regulator | Kentucky Department of Financial Institutions (DFI) Source says: "The Department of Financial Institutions' mission is to serve Kentucky residents by promoting access to a stable financial industry, implementing effective and efficient regulatory oversight". | Kentucky Department of Financial Institutions as of 2026-09-16 |
| Payday lending status | Permitted under license (deferred deposit service business; payday loans) Source says: "The Kentucky Department of Financial Institutions (DFI) has secured the services of Veritec Solutions, LLC to provide a common database with real-time access for deferred deposit transactions". | Kentucky Department of Financial Institutions as of 2026-09-16 |
| Small-loan / installment lender licensing | Consumer Loan Company license required (KRS Chapter 286.4) Source says: "How to License a Consumer Loan Company: 1. Read KRS 286.4 and the applicable administrative regulations under KAR 808, Chapter 6". | Kentucky Department of Financial Institutions as of 2026-09-16 |
